‘RedHanded is a rollicking listen’ – The Guardian

RedHanded is an award winning true crime podcast that offers a weekly dose of murder and wit delivered with all the facts, anecdotal tangents aplenty, serious societal scrutiny and real BRITISH flavour.

3 years ago hosts Hannah Maguire and Suruthi Bala met at a party, they got drunk and decided to start a true crime podcast together. Within months they had started recording the very first episodes of RedHanded, with a £10 microphone, locked in a cupboard under Hannah’s stairs.

Today, RedHanded is an internationally-renowned, hit podcast with thousands of self-proclaimed ‘Spooky Bitches’ tuning in every week.

With two intelligent, opinionated, “big-mouthed” women at the helm, this podcast was never going to tow the line; but it was never meant to.

It was meant to disrupt.

Hannah and Suruthi both felt that true crime needed dragging into the world of today – no more raspy voice-overs subtly blaming the victim or totally ignoring the blatant societal issues around racism, homophobia, misogyny, politics, mental illness, corruption, religion, injustice and inequality that feed into every crime; this was going to be different.

And it’s working – RedHanded’s bold exploration of these issues coupled with the hosts’ sharp wit, sense of humour, deep research and refreshing case selection has seen the show gain international acclaim and a legion of ‘rabid’ fans.
